I am passionate about helping children, teens and their families work
toward their healthiest self. This could mean learning regulation
techniques, developing insight or developing secure relationships.
Growing up is difficult, and each stage presents compounded
challenges. Children and teens can feel isolated, confused, or
frustrated with emotional and behavioral experiences separating them
from who they want to be. There is freedom in lowering the symptoms
and increasing the skills, as well as understanding as a parent, how
you can help.

I use a relational and trauma-informed approach to therapy. I find
this is the best way to use my varied experience and knowledge to
apply to your unique life experiences and goals. I pull from models of
CBT, DBT, experiential techniques and trauma informed strengths-based
methods. This includes the teaching, practice and mastery of
emotion-regulation, interpersonal skills and thought restructuring
that target core difficulties our children often feel impacted by. I
further look forward to parent inclusion as appropriate to support the
understanding, practice and mastery for continuing the work outside of
the office. I believe in transformative change that can impact not
just an individual, but can bring benefit and peace to a household,
and a community.

I am a Licensed Clinical Mental Health Counselor and hold a masters
degree in Clinical Mental Health Counseling and have over 6 years of
varied experience working in intensive, crisis, inpatient and
outpatient settings with children and teens.
